Opioid tapering after spine surgery: Protocol for a randomized controlled trial.

Peter Uhrbrand1,2, Anne Phillipsen2, Mikkel M Rasmussen3

  • 1Department of Anaesthesiology and Intensive Care, Aarhus University Hospital, Aarhus, Denmark.

Acta Anaesthesiologica Scandinavica
|March 12, 2020
PubMed
Summary

Post-surgery opioid tapering plans and follow-up can help reduce opioid use in patients. This study investigated the effectiveness of customized tapering plans and telephone counseling for reducing long-term opioid consumption after spine surgery.

Area of Science:

  • Clinical Medicine
  • Surgical Outcomes
  • Pain Management

Background:

  • Opioid prescriptions are common for patients post-surgery.
  • Many patients continue opioid use after hospital discharge, failing to taper.
  • Effective tapering strategies are needed to manage post-surgical opioid consumption.

Purpose of the Study:

  • To evaluate the impact of customized opioid tapering plans and telephone counseling on post-surgical opioid use.
  • To determine if an intervention reduces the number of patients exceeding preoperative opioid intake.
  • To assess secondary outcomes including withdrawal symptoms and patient satisfaction.

Main Methods:

  • A single-center, randomized controlled trial involving 110 patients undergoing spine surgery.
  • Patients with preoperative opioid use were randomized into an intervention group (tapering plan + telephone counseling) or a control group.
  • The primary outcome was the proportion of patients exceeding preoperative opioid intake one month post-discharge.

Main Results:

  • The study is expected to provide data on the effectiveness of the intervention in reducing opioid consumption.
  • Analysis will focus on the primary outcome and secondary outcomes such as withdrawal symptoms and complete tapering.

Conclusions:

  • The study aims to offer valuable insights into opioid tapering strategies for patients with preoperative opioid use undergoing surgery.
  • Findings could inform clinical practice guidelines for post-operative pain management and opioid stewardship.
